Exploring Medical Practice Models: Inside the Hospital Employed Practice Model Guest: Anand Shridharani, MD, FACS Host: Micheal Darson, MD The hospital employed practice is becoming more common - but what does it actually mean for providers? In this episode, Dr. Anand Shridharani joins host, Dr. Micheal Darson, to explore how this practice model functions, it's benefits and drawbacks, and what providers should weigh when considering entering into hospital employment. From compensation structures to clinical autonomy and adminstrative support, Drs. Shridharani and Darson unpack the nuances of this model and what makes it distinct in today's healthcare landscape.
